Synopsis
Ye Tianchen, a divine level expert from a post-apocalyptic future, finds himself reborn in a modern city. While he initially seeks a quiet life, the betrayal of his family and the cruelty of those who once knew him force him to abandon his restraint. He now aims to assert his dominance over a world that underestimated him. This novel follows the classic rebirth power fantasy trope, evoking the feel of urban dramas where a powerful individual systematically dismantles his enemies. It is ideal for readers who enjoy wish-fulfillment and seeing an oppressed protagonist rise to absolute power. However, those seeking a nuanced plot or grounded character arcs should look elsewhere. The narrative is a long-form journey, with the sheer volume of chapters suggesting a repetitive cycle of conflict and escalation that emphasizes the protagonist's overwhelming strength over intricate storytelling.

Editorial Review
From an editorial perspective, the most striking aspect of this work is its sheer scale. With nearly two thousand chapters, the author has demonstrated an incredible commitment to the narrative, providing a vast amount of content for dedicated fans of the urban genre. This suggests a deeply fleshed-out progression and a wide array of conflicts. However, the extremely low visibility indicated by the view count is a significant red flag, suggesting the story may struggle to engage a broad audience or suffers from a lack of promotional reach. Additionally, the reliance on common tropes—such as the betrayed protagonist returning to power—runs the risk of becoming formulaic over such a long duration. While the volume offers high value in terms of reading time, the lack of popularity suggests the execution may not stand out from a crowded field of similar urban thrillers.
